Electric Heater Setup

Inside, this sauna holds about 8.8 m³ of air, about the size of a small box room. To get that properly hot you want roughly 8kW of heat, and the Harvia BC80 / BC60 Electric Heater Set is the one we'd point you at. Anything between 8kW and 12kW will do the job, so it comes down to how it looks, how you control it and what you want to spend. Our heater size calculator shows how we got to that and lists every heater that fits this model.

A heater this size can usually run off a normal household supply, but it pulls a lot of power, so your fusebox needs to have room for it. Your electrician will tell you in five minutes whether yours does. Whichever heater you pick, check what it needs before you buy.

The heater gets wired straight into your electrics by a qualified electrician. Never a plug, never an extension lead. If you're near us in Leicestershire we can arrange the electrician for you for a fee, so it's all done in one go. There's more detail in our full guide to electric heater setup.

Two things worth doing before you buy: our running cost calculator tells you what a session will cost to heat, and our solar calculator works out the panels and battery you'd need if you'd rather run it from the sun.

Wood-Fired Heater Setup

Inside, this sauna holds about 8.8 m³ of air, about the size of a small box room. The Cozy 12 OG Wood Burning Heater is the stove we'd suggest for it, and anything from the 12kW to the 24kW will work. Our heater size calculator shows how we worked that out and what else fits.

A wood stove needs no electrics at all, but it does get extremely hot. It has to sit a set distance from the timber walls and benches, usually with a heat shield behind it, and something fireproof underneath in case an ember drops out. The stove instructions give you the exact distances. The walls are solid timber with no insulation layer, so it takes a bit longer to warm up.

The chimney runs up and out through the roof. The chimney goes up through the roof panel, so that hole needs cutting and sealing properly. The fire also needs air to burn, and the room needs a vent low down and another high up so fresh air comes in and damp gets out. Have a think about where the smoke will blow, in relation to your house, your neighbours and where you sit outside.

Before you build, run our sauna build checker. It checks your vents, bench heights, clearances and drainage in a couple of minutes and flags anything that'll cause you grief later. Our full guide to wood-fired heater setup covers the rest. It's also worth a quick check with your council, as some areas have rules about chimneys and smoke.

Cleaning & Care

The Beacon 220 XL — Full Front Glass — Thermowood needs standard Beacon range care, with its wider diameter making no difference to the fundamental maintenance routine. After every session, leave the door open for twenty to thirty minutes to let the heat room dry out fully, preventing mould and dark staining on timber surfaces. Wipe benches down once cooled, and sand the interior lightly once or twice a year wherever contact is heaviest.

If fitted with the optional window, clean it with a standard glass cleaner and soft cloth. Check the door seal periodically, particularly during the sauna's first year as everything settles in.

Externally, treat the Thermowood exterior with a wood treatment every two to three years depending on weather exposure. Keep the base area clear of leaves and standing water, the same fundamental principle that applies to any outdoor timber sauna regardless of diameter or specific format.

Delivery

Production takes 10-12 weeks, plus 1-2 weeks dispatch time for pallet haulage. This sauna is delivered flat packed unless otherwise stated. Free UK mainland shipping applies. If your order exceeds standard pallet limits due to length, weight, or quantity, additional pallet charges may apply and are quoted separately based on postcode.

Deliveries are kerbside and unloaded using the vehicle's tail lift, so no machinery or extra help is needed on your side. For properties with tight or restricted access, we can arrange delivery on a smaller vehicle with the goods handballed off instead — just let us know your access situation before ordering.

Please have a solid, level base and clear access ready before delivery. Pallet deliveries are kerbside only, and once unloaded you're responsible for moving the goods onto your property. Final positioning is not included unless you use our installation team. A comprehensive assembly manual is included, and self-assembly is straightforward with basic DIY skills.
